An old hen house with a gin distillery, farm shop and ladies waiting room has been crowned Shed of the Year.
The once dilapidated outhouse in Aviemore in the Scottish Highlands was transformed by Walter Micklethwait (36) into a quirky party venue.
Inshriach Distillery has four rooms and beat 2,520 other entries to win the title, including a mobile miniature railway wagon, a floating beach hut and a corrugated cottage which was used by the Women's Land Army in World War II.
